Different Services Offered by Meth Detox in Mifflin

DetoxificationDetoxification is the cornerstone of treatment at rehab centers for Meth Detox in Mifflin. This initial stage involves medically supervised clearing of meth from the system, which can induce withdrawal symptoms. The duration and intensity of detox can vary greatly depending on individual circumstances. Supervised by healthcare professionals, the process ensures safety and comfort, using medications when necessary to alleviate severe symptoms. A successful detox lays the foundation for subsequent therapeutic interventions, making it vital for long-term recovery. Furthermore, it serves to stabilize individuals emotionally and physically, enhancing their readiness to engage deeply in the recovery process.
Inpatient TreatmentInpatient treatment programs provide an immersive recovery experience at rehab centers for Meth Detox in Mifflin. This residential program immerses individuals in a supportive environment where they can focus solely on recovery away from distractions and triggers associated with their previous lifestyle. Typically lasting 30 to 90 days, inpatient treatment offers round-the-clock care and access to various therapeutic modalities, nurturing a comprehensive healing process. Through individual and group therapies, patients build coping skills, develop recovery plans, and establish a strong support network with peers facing similar challenges. This structured atmosphere significantly enhances the chances of a sustained recovery in the long run.
Outpatient TreatmentOutpatient treatment programs at Meth Detox rehab centers in Mifflin allow for flexibility, enabling individuals to attend therapy sessions while maintaining their daily responsibilities. This model is ideal for those who have completed detox or inpatient treatment and require continued support to ensure long-lasting sobriety. Patients participate in scheduled sessions that include individual therapy, group discussions, and educational workshops, providing ongoing motivation and accountability. Outpatient programs emphasize personal responsibility and engagement, equipping individuals with practical tools and strategies to maintain their recovery while integrating back into everyday life.
12-Step and Non-12-Step ProgramsRehab centers for Meth Detox in Mifflin offer both 12-step and non-12-step options for patients seeking support in recovery. The 12-step approach, founded by Alcoholics Anonymous, focuses on spiritual growth and accountability through community support. Participants attend regular meetings, share experiences, and utilize the steps to navigate recovery challenges. Conversely, non-12-step programs provide alternative pathways that may be more suited for those uncomfortable with a spiritual framework. These may include cognitive-behavioral therapy, motivational interviewing, and holistic therapies, offering diverse strategies to support a person’s recovery journey. Both approaches highlight the importance of community and support in the healing process.
Counseling and TherapyCounseling and therapy services are integral to the recovery process at Meth Detox rehab centers in Mifflin, addressing the psychological aspects of addiction. Individual counseling allows patients to explore their feelings, thoughts, and behaviors surrounding drug use, fostering personal insight and facilitating change. Group therapy encourages sharing experiences and support among peers, reducing feelings of isolation. Specialized therapies such as cognitive-behavioral therapy (CBT) equip individuals with effective coping mechanisms to handle triggers and cravings. Continuous support through therapy helps cultivate emotional resilience, which is critical for navigating the complexities of life post-treatment. These services not only assist individuals in overcoming their addiction but also promote personal growth and mental well-being.
Aftercare ServicesAftercare services provided by rehab centers for Meth Detox in Mifflin play a crucial role in maintaining sobriety post-treatment. These services include ongoing counseling, support groups, and relapse prevention planning designed to reinforce the skills learned during treatment. Aftercare often facilitates connections to community resources that provide continued guidance, allowing individuals to navigate their journey in recovery with a solid support network. Engaging in aftercare significantly decreases the chances of relapse and fosters a sense of continuity and commitment to a healthier lifestyle. Comprehensive aftercare planning equips individuals with tools to face challenges and stresses, reaffirming their goal of lasting recovery.
Cost of Meth Detox in Mifflin
Insurance CoverageRehab centers for Meth Detox in Mifflin typically collaborate with various insurance providers. Insurance coverage can significantly mitigate the financial burden associated with addiction treatment. Understanding one’s insurance plan is vital; many policies cover a range of services, including detox, inpatient, and outpatient programs. Patients are encouraged to contact their insurance company directly to clarify benefits, co-pays, and potential out-of-pocket expenses. The centers also provide staff assistance in navigating insurance paperwork, ensuring that individuals receive the necessary treatment without financial deterrents.
Payment PlansMany rehab centers for Meth Detox in Mifflin offer flexible payment plans to accommodate those without insurance or a sufficient coverage plan. These plans can be customized based on individual financial circumstances, allowing patients to spread out the costs of treatment over time. Payment installments are typically designed to ease the financial strain while ensuring that individuals receive the help they need without delay. This financial flexibility is essential because it assures patients that they can commit to treatment without crippling their finances or incurring debt.
Government GrantsIndividuals seeking treatment for meth addiction in Mifflin may also explore government grants available for addiction recovery. These grants aim to support people from low-income backgrounds or those who are uninsured. Various state and federal programs allocate funding to help individuals access vital treatment services and rehabilitation programs. By researching available grants, patients can discover financial avenues that could significantly reduce the overall cost of their treatment. Rehab centers often have resources to assist potential clients in completing grant applications, providing a pathway to recovery that is financially feasible.
ScholarshipsScholarships for addiction treatment are another significant financial resource available through many rehab centers for Meth Detox in Mifflin. Nonprofit organizations, local charities, and specific rehab facilities often provide financial aid to individuals in need, enabling access to necessary therapies without overwhelming financial obligations. Scholarships may cover a portion or even the entire cost of treatment, depending on specific criteria and needs assessment conducted by the facility. Inquire about scholarship opportunities to discover potential assistance that aligns with recovery needs.
Sliding Scale FeesSome rehab centers for Meth Detox in Mifflin utilize sliding scale fees, a payment model that adjusts the cost of treatment based on the patient's financial ability. This approach ensures that individuals have access to services regardless of their economic situation and acknowledges the varying financial circumstances of clients. The sliding scale mechanism promotes inclusivity and affordability in addiction treatment, reflecting a commitment to providing necessary support to all individuals struggling with meth addiction. Those interested should consult directly with the facility to assess their eligibility and understand the associated fees.
Financial Assistance ProgramsNumerous rehab centers for Meth Detox in Mifflin participate in financial assistance programs specifically designed to help individuals secure the treatment they require. Such programs might include state-funded rehabilitation services, local community initiatives, or partnerships with nonprofit organizations. The process typically involves an assessment of needs and the financial situation to determine the best course of action. These assistance programs aim to reduce barriers to treatment so that all individuals can focus primarily on recovery without the stress of financial strain.
